Lara Dutta Returns to India After Dubai Ordeal Amid Israel-Iran Conflict
Lara Dutta's Return to India During Conflict
Bollywood star Lara Dutta found herself among numerous Indian celebrities trapped in Dubai due to the escalating Israel-Iran conflict. She shared a video on social media, voicing her worries about being caught in such a precarious situation. Thankfully, Lara has safely returned to India with her 14-year-old daughter, Saira. In a recent interview, she mentioned that she typically avoids sharing such videos to prevent causing unnecessary alarm. Lara recounted the 'dangerous journey' they undertook to return home, expressing uncertainty about what lay ahead.
Lara Dutta's Experience During the Crisis
In a conversation with a media outlet, Lara disclosed that she and her daughter were alone when the conflict erupted, while her husband, Mahesh Bhupathi, was in London for work commitments. The actress had relocated to Dubai for Saira to train with a prestigious tennis coach. Despite the tense atmosphere, Lara praised the UAE government for their efforts in ensuring the safety of residents.
Discussing their return journey, Lara explained that they opted for a flight from Fujairah, following instructions to remain indoors due to the escalating tensions. "We lived just about 10 kms away from the Jebel Ali Port, which was being bombed every day. So we decided to take a chance, as I wanted to be with my husband and my family. We drove two hours to Fujairah, and just a day earlier, Fujairah port and the oil refinery had been bombed. It was scary. I was joking with my co-star Akshay Kumar that I felt like I was part of Airlift 2," she shared.
She further mentioned that they could hear explosions at the airport and hoped that 'nothing was struck'. Lara also acknowledged the airlines for their efforts, noting that her daughter might experience some trauma from this ordeal.
